Mortgages are structured so that the percentage of your payment that goes toward your primary shifts as the years pass. In the beginning, you're paying mainly interest; ultimately, you'll pay mainly principal.

The interest rates on adjustable rate home loans are changed at predetermined intervals to show the present market. Some mortgages are a mix of fixed and adjustable: for the first 3, 5 or seven years, the rate will remain repaired, and then be changed every year for the period of the loan.
This kind of loan might be right for you if you prepare to reside in your home for approximately the exact same length of time as the original fixed term. A home mortgage is a loan secured to buy home or land. A lot of run for 25 years but the term can be shorter or longer. The loan is 'protected' against the value of your home till it's settled. If you can't keep up your payments the loan provider can repossess (reclaim) your house and offer it so they get their refund.
